WebCryptochromes (CRY) are photolyase-like blue-light receptors that mediate light responses in plants and animals. How plant cryptochromes act in response to blue light is not well understood. We report here the identification and characterization of the Arabidopsis CIB1 (cryptochrome-interacting basic-helix-loop-helix) protein. WebOct 10, 2024 · Of note, the CRY2/CIB1 system had a consistently higher light-dependent induction with a notable amount of leakiness as shown by the higher Luc signal in dark compared to the FKF1/GI-based system.
